Allison Transmission is the world’s largest manufacturer of commercial-duty automatic transmissions and hybrid propulsion systems, with products used by over 300 leading vehicle manufacturers across various sectors. Founded in 1915 in Indianapolis, Indiana, where its global headquarters remains, Allison has approximately 1,400 dealer and distributor locations, employs over 2,700 people worldwide, and has an international presence spanning more than 80 countries.
